SDIC Power's controlling subsidiary Yalong River Hydropower plans to establish a joint venture with CATL to invest in and build the Yagen II hydropower station, with a total dynamic investment of 33.394 billion yuan. The Yagen II hydropower station is located on the main stream of the Yalong River in Yajiang County, Garze Prefecture, Sichuan Province. It is the third stage of the 'one reservoir, seven stages' hydropower development plan for the middle reaches of the Yalong River, with a total installed capacity of 2.4 million kilowatts and an estimated annual power generation of about 8.645 billion kilowatt-hours. The total construction period is 101 months, with the first unit expected to be commissioned in 2035 and full completion in 2036. The joint venture company will be 90% owned by Yalong River Hydropower and 10% by CATL. On a look-through basis, SDIC Power will hold an effective stake of about 46.8%, Sichuan Chuantou Energy about 43.2%, and CATL 10%. The investment has been approved by the board of directors of SDIC Power and still requires approval from the National Development and Reform Commission. For SDIC Power, the project will enhance the profitability of Yalong River Hydropower. The exploitable hydropower capacity in the Yalong River basin is about 30 million kilowatts, of which 19.2 million kilowatts are already in operation. For CATL, this marks another hydropower investment following its stake in the Danba hydropower station on the Dadu River, aiming to secure green electricity supply, reduce the carbon footprint of batteries, address the EU carbon border tax and new battery regulations, and explore new models of hydro-storage synergy.
